Questions about Upstox
- Does Upstox allow copy trading?
- Not automatically through TrueFills today. Upstox supports a read-only connection, which means a record held at Upstox can be read and verified, but no order can be placed in the account. You can still follow a strategy and place its trades yourself, and you can publish a verified record of your own Upstox trading.
- Does TrueFills see my Upstox password?
- No. The sign-in happens on Upstox’s own page, and TrueFills receives a connection rather than your credentials. You can revoke it at Upstox or here, independently.
- Where does my money sit?
- In your own Upstox account, throughout. TrueFills never takes custody of funds and cannot move money out of a brokerage account. A trading connection can place orders; it cannot withdraw.
